PORTABLE HANDS-FREE BRACKET
A portable hands-free bracket includes: a wearing unit, a support protective plate, an angle adjustment unit, and a receiving tube; wherein the wearing unit being for the user to wear around the waist; the support protective plate being disposed at the wearing unit and pressing against user abdomen when in use; the angle adjustment unit being installed at the support protective plate to receive the receiving tube, and able to adjust and fix the angle at which the receiving tube tilting outwards from the support protective plate; and the receiving tube having a housing space for insertion and placement. As such, the user wears the wearing unit around waist with supporting clamping device holding a smart phone and placed in receiving tube, to view the display hands-free.
The present disclosure generally relates to a portable hands-free apparatus technical field, and in particularly, related to a hands-free bracket tied to the abdominal area of a user for holding smart phones, to achieve hands-free viewing of the smart phone.
BACKGROUNDConventional hands-free apparatuses for portable electronic devices are fastened to an object, such as, windshield, glass, wall or desk top, and clamp to hold the portable electronic device. As such, a user can view the video played on the electronic device comfortably by adjusting the viewing angle and distance. However, as the hands-free apparatus is fastened to a stationary place, when the user changes position, the viewing angle and distance with respect to the display also changes. In addition, when the user sits on a sofa or lies in bed without a hard-surfaced object for the hand-free apparatus to be fastened to, the user is often forced to hold the electronic device in hand, which is inconvenient to use for viewing for an extended period of time.
SUMMARYThe primary object of the present disclosure is to provide a portable hands-free bracket, to be fastened to the abdominal area of a user, for holding light-weighted objects. For close-range use of portable electronic device, such as, smart phone, the bracket of the present disclosure may be used with additional supporting clamping device to clamp onto the electronic device in front of the chest area so that the user can view the display of the electronic device comfortably.
To achieve the aforementioned object, an exemplary embodiment provides a portable hands-free bracket, including: a wearing unit, a support protective plate, an angle adjustment unit, and a receiving tube; wherein the wearing unit being for the user to wear around the waist, the wearing unit being able to change length depending on the user waist; the support protective plate being disposed at the wearing unit; the angle adjustment unit being installed at the support protective plate to receive the receiving tube, and able to adjust and fix the angle at which the receiving tube tilting outwards from the support protective plate; and the receiving tube having a housing space for insertion and placement.

The wearing unit 1 is for the user to wear the present disclosure around the waist. The wearing unit 1 is able to change length to accommodate the waist change of the user. The structure of the wearing unit 1 may be similar to a conventional belt, and no specific restriction is imposed here. The following exemplar shows an embodiment of the wearing unit 1, including an adjustable belt 11 and a belt buckle 12. The belt buckle is connected to the adjustable belt 11. The adjustable belt 11 includes a movable element 111. The length of the adjustable belt 11 is changed by adjusting the position of the movable element 111. The adjustable belt 11 passes through the hole trench 24 to connect with a side of the support protective plate 2, and the other side of the support protective plate 2 is buckled at the hole trench 23 by the belt buckle 12. As such, the wearing unit 1 is worn around the waist. In addition, the wearing unit 1 can also be realized by belt with adhesive fastener.

Claims
1. A portable hands-free bracket, comprising:
- a wearing unit, for the user to wear around the waist, the wearing unit being able to change length depending on the user waist;
- a support protective plate, disposed at the wearing unit;
- an angle adjustment unit, installed at the support protective plate to receive the receiving tube, and able to adjust and fix the angle at which the receiving tube tilting outwards from the support protective plate; and
- a receiving tube, having a housing space for insertion and placement.
2. The portable hands-free bracket as claimed in claim 1, wherein the support protective plate further comprises two hole trenches, located close to the left and right sides of the support protective plate respectively; the wearing unit comprises an adjustable belt and a belt buckle, the belt buckle is connected to the adjustable belt, the adjustable belt passes through one of the hole trenches to connect with a side of the support protective plate, and the other side of the support protective plate is buckled at the other hole trench by the belt buckle.
3. The portable hands-free bracket as claimed in claim 2, wherein the angle adjustment unit is installed on the support protective plate between the two hole trenches.
4. The portable hands-free bracket as claimed in claim 1, wherein the support protective plate has a first side and a second side, opposite to each other, and the first side has a concave curvy surface to contact the abdominal area of the user when in use.
5. The portable hands-free bracket as claimed in claim 4, wherein the first angle adjustment unit is installed at the second side, located at a position with a distance to the top edge smaller than a distance to the bottom edge of the support protective plate.
6. The portable hands-free bracket as claimed in claim 4, wherein each of the first and the second angle adjustment units comprises: a coupling base, a coupling tube, an axial element and a flip lock element; the coupling base has a U shape and protrudes on the second side of the support protective plate, the coupling tube is formed at the first end of support rod; the coupling tube is installed inside the coupling base, and the axial element passes through the coupling tube and the coupling base; the flip lock element is coupled to one end of the axial element and contacts the outside wall of the coupling base; when the flip lock element is flipped to a lock state, the coupling tube is tightly clamped by the coupling base and the angle of the support rod with respect to the support protective plate is fixed; and when the flip lock element is flipped to an unlock state, the coupling base and the coupling tube are loosely coupled, and angle adjustment can be performed.
7. The portable hands-free bracket as claimed in claim 6, wherein the surfaces of U shape facing each other are disposed with teeth surface element, and each of the two ends of the coupling tube forms a ring teeth.
8. The portable hands-free bracket as claimed in claim 1, wherein the support protective plate has a shield shape.
